Cowpea (English name) Vigna unguiculata (L.) Walp. (=V.sinensis Endl.)
An annual plant of the legume family (illustration), grown for its edible young pods and ripe beans, and for its foliage and green manure. Also called cowpea. Native to Africa, it was introduced to India and Southeast Asia in ancient times. It is believed to have been introduced to Japan from China by the 9th century. It was also introduced to Europe in the 3rd century BC. There are many varieties of cowpea. There are also differentiated cultivars such as V. u.ssp . cylindrica (L.) Van Eseltine (= V. catjang (Burm.f.) Walp) and V. u.var . sesquipedalis (L.) Verde (= V. sesquipedalis (L.) Fruw.), but these are all collectively treated as cowpea.
